>             given a complete binary tree (either a node is a leaf node or
> has two children)
>
> every leaf node has value 0 or 1.
> every internal node has value as the AND gate or OR gate.
> you are given with the tree and a value V.
> you have to output the minimum number of flips (AND to OR or OR to AND) if
> the evaluated value is not equal to V, if it is equal return 0, if not
> possible return -1.
> you can just change the value of internal nodes i.e can make and to or , or
> to and to get the desired output
> give the minimum number of flips required to get the desired output.
